首页
/ Snap Hutao游戏启动器注入模块导致游戏异常问题分析

Snap Hutao游戏启动器注入模块导致游戏异常问题分析

2025-06-13 01:30:18作者:齐添朝

问题现象

近期有用户反馈,在使用Snap Hutao游戏启动器的注入模块功能后,出现了无法进入游戏的严重问题。具体表现为:启动游戏后系统提示"数据异常,请完全卸载游戏,并从官方渠道重新下载安装 错误码:31-4302"。即使用户尝试通过官方启动器或直接启动游戏,该错误依然持续存在。

问题根源

经过分析,该问题的根本原因是用户手动修改了游戏的核心文件mhypbase.dll。这个文件是原神游戏的关键组件之一,任何未经授权的修改都会触发游戏的完整性检查机制。值得注意的是,即使用户执行了游戏内或官方启动器的资源检查功能,系统也没有自动修复这个被修改的文件,这导致了问题的持续存在。

技术背景

游戏客户端通常会包含多种完整性保护机制:

  1. 关键文件校验:游戏会检查核心文件是否被篡改
  2. 内存校验:防止运行时内存被修改
  3. 反作弊系统:检测异常的游戏行为

在本次案例中,mhypbase.dll文件的修改触发了第一种保护机制。虽然资源检查功能理论上应该能修复这类问题,但实际运行中可能存在某些特殊情况导致修复机制未能正常工作。

解决方案

对于遇到类似问题的用户,可以采取以下步骤解决:

  1. 手动恢复原始mhypbase.dll文件
  2. 完全卸载游戏客户端
  3. 从官方渠道重新下载安装游戏
  4. 避免未经授权修改任何游戏文件

预防措施

为了避免类似问题再次发生,建议用户:

  1. 谨慎使用第三方修改工具
  2. 修改游戏文件前做好备份
  3. 了解修改可能带来的风险
  4. 定期验证游戏文件完整性

总结

本次案例提醒我们,游戏文件的完整性对游戏运行至关重要。任何未经授权的修改都可能导致不可预知的问题。作为用户,应当理解并尊重游戏开发者的版权保护措施,避免因不当修改导致游戏无法正常运行。同时,这也反映出游戏资源检查机制在某些边缘情况下可能存在不足,值得开发者进一步优化。

登录后查看全文
热门项目推荐
相关项目推荐